Thunderstorms may be severe across Maryland Thursday afternoon, according to the National Weather Service.

Forecasters say the storms could bring damaging winds and large hail through Thursday night.

Tornadoes, flash flooding and lightning may also be in store between 2 p.m. and midnight, according to the National Weather Service.

"Isolated tornadoes are possible this afternoon and this evening," the National Weather Service said in a hazardous weather outlook for much of the state. "Additionally, isolated occurrences of flash flooding are also possible."... Read More: Pikesville Patch
